Transaction 13ca3e51baaf00fb48d6aaa28388a7ae2e540a07cd823339740d34bdae9c17e9
1 Input
1 Output
-
13ca3e51baaf00fb48d6aaa28388a7ae2e540a07cd823339740d34bdae9c17e9:0
- value
- 8642589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bfea6f4fd8b4330f572edeb4056ada96a297eee OP_EQUAL
- address
- 3LHeA2cmGkNTFbetF64RRgk6aVCTeZwZdd